First: What Mag-10 actually is (and isn't)

Mag-10 is built around one core advantage: extremely fast amino acid delivery. Its protein comes almost entirely from di- and tri-peptides, which bypass normal digestion. Rapidly absorbed di- and tri-peptides accelerate protein synthesis and double muscle gains compared to whey hydrolysate (Demling 2000). That is the defining feature. Everything else in the formula supports that goal:

  • Di- and tri-peptides for rapid amino availability
  • Highly branched cyclic dextrin (HBCD) for quick but controlled glycogen replenishment
  • Isomaltulose for sustained energy and insulin stability
  • Electrolytes for hydration and cellular uptake

Mag-10 isn't really about hitting daily protein totals. It's about changing the timing, speed, and metabolic impact of protein delivery.

Older lifters who don't recover like they used to

Age changes protein metabolism. Older muscle is less sensitive to amino acids and slower to respond. Rapidly absorbed peptides help overcome that resistance by delivering amino acids quickly and in high concentration when muscle is primed for uptake. Lifters over 35 report less lingering soreness, better next-day readiness, improved muscle fullness, and better training consistency.

Endurance and hybrid athletes

Mag-10 is underrated outside bodybuilding circles. Cyclists, runners, CrossFit athletes, and field sport athletes benefit from faster glycogen reload, improved hydration, and less muscle breakdown during long sessions. The peptide-carb-electrolyte combo makes it useful both post-training and between same-day workouts.
